    Depends on your lighting type more then tank hell you can keep on in a bucket as long as the water parameters are stable and the lighting is of proper type and strength. As for size ? I have had them up wards of 10" to 12" or so I never took a rule to them . But if you get a oh saw 3" maxima and had it for 5 or 7 yrs or so then you may need to move it out ? as long as it has room to fully open then it has enough room .

    ive seen them kept in them, just make sure you keep your bulbs replaced every 9 months or so even though their T5 their still based on PC hardware in the RSM so the bulbs don't seem to last that long
